Career path

Career Role Description
Quantum Cryptography Engineer Develops and implements secure quantum communication systems, focusing on encryption and key distribution protocols. High demand in government and finance.
Quantum Network Architect Designs and builds the infrastructure for quantum communication networks, integrating quantum devices and classical components. Crucial for expanding quantum internet capabilities.
Quantum Communication Consultant Advises organizations on implementing quantum communication technologies, assessing feasibility and risk, and developing strategic plans. Requires strong communication and technical skills.
Quantum Software Developer Develops software for quantum communication systems, controlling quantum hardware and processing quantum data. Significant growth potential with quantum computing advancements.
